Step 1
Preheat the oven to 400 degrees.
Step 2
Grease a baking sheet, set aside.
Step 3
Mix the milk and vinegar together, set aside to curdle while you continue.
Step 4
In a large bowl add the flour, sugar, salt, and soda together. Stir gently.
Step 5
When the milk has curdled (about 8-10 minutes) slowly add it to the flour mixture, stir gently to work it in.
Step 6
Stop mixing just when the milk has been worked in (the dough will be wet) and turn the dough out onto a well-floured surface.
Step 7
Knead the dough until a soft dough has formed and can be shaped into a large ball-shaped loaf. (reminder...the dough will be very wet and hard to work, at first!)
Step 8
Keeping a sharp knife floured, cut a X shape into the top of your dough.
Step 9
Place the dough ball on to your greased baking sheet.
Step 10
Bake for 30-40 minutes or until golden brown.
